- ShaahuMay 23, 2023 · 2 years agoLeverage Bitcoin ETFs work similarly to traditional ETFs, but with the added feature of leverage. These ETFs use derivatives such as futures contracts to gain exposure to Bitcoin. By using leverage, investors can control a larger position in Bitcoin with a smaller amount of capital. This can potentially amplify profits, but it also increases the risk of losses. It's important for investors to carefully assess their risk tolerance and thoroughly understand the mechanics of leverage before investing in Bitcoin ETFs.
